Understanding Smart TV Features

When it comes to selecting a 65-inch smart TV, understanding the essential features is crucial for making an informed decision. One of the first aspects to consider is resolution. Most modern smart TVs offer 4K resolution, which provides four times the pixel count of Full HD, resulting in sharper images and more vibrant colors. Additionally, look for features like High Dynamic Range (HDR) that enhance the contrast and color range of the content being displayed. Another important feature is the smart capabilities of the TV, including built-in streaming apps like Netflix, Hulu, and YouTube. These features allow users to access a vast library of content without the need for external devices. Furthermore, consider the user interface; a straightforward and intuitive menu can greatly enhance your viewing experience. Display Technology Options

Display technology plays a pivotal role in the performance and quality of your 65-inch smart TV. There are several options available, including LED, OLED, and QLED, each with its advantages and disadvantages. LED TVs are typically more affordable and offer bright images, making them a popular choice for well-lit rooms. However, they may not deliver the same level of contrast as their OLED counterparts. OLED technology, on the other hand, provides stunning picture quality with deep blacks and vibrant colors, thanks to its self-lighting pixels. This makes it ideal for movie nights in darker settings. QLED TVs, which use quantum dot technology, aim to combine the best of both worlds, offering impressive brightness and color accuracy. Smart TV Operating Systems

The operating system of a smart TV can significantly impact your overall experience. Various platforms, such as Android TV, Tizen, and WebOS, come with unique features, usability, and app availability. For instance, Android TV offers a robust app ecosystem and voice search capabilities, making it an excellent choice for tech-savvy users who enjoy exploring new applications. On the other hand, Tizen, often found in Samsung TVs, is known for its sleek interface and compatibility with smart home devices. WebOS, which powers LG TVs, is praised for its simple navigation and the ability to switch between apps seamlessly. Compatibility with other devices, such as smartphones and tablets, is another crucial factor. A smooth and intuitive operating system can enhance your viewing experience, making it easier to access content and manage connected devices. Connectivity and Compatibility

Connectivity options are vital when selecting a 65-inch smart TV, as they determine how easily you can connect other devices to enhance your viewing experience. Look for multiple HDMI ports, as they allow you to connect devices like gaming consoles, Blu-ray players, and sound systems. Additionally, USB ports are beneficial for playing media directly from external drives. Wi-Fi connectivity is a must-have for streaming services, but consider the option of Ethernet for a more stable connection. It's also essential to ensure compatibility with popular streaming devices, such as streaming sticks and soundbars, to create a seamless entertainment setup. Tips for Choosing the Right 65-Inch Smart TV

Before making a purchase, consider several practical tips to ensure you choose the right 65-inch smart TV for your home. First, assess the size of your room and the viewing distance. Ideally, you should sit at a distance that allows you to enjoy the screen without straining your eyes. A common recommendation is to sit approximately 1.5 to 2.5 times the diagonal size of the TV away from the screen for optimal viewing. Next, think about your personal preferences; whether you prioritize gaming, movie watching, or casual streaming will influence your choice. Lastly, don’t forget to consider your budget. While it’s tempting to opt for the latest technology, it’s essential to find a balance between features and price that suits your needs.
